Rice, commonly known as rice, is an annual aquatic herb in the Poaceae family (there are already perennial rice varieties). The stem is upright, 0.5-1.5 meters high, and varies with the variety. The leaf sheath is hairless and loose; The leaf tongue is lanceolate; Leaves linear lanceolate, about 1 cm wide, hairless, rough. The panicle is large and sparsely spread, with rough edges; Spikelets contain 1 mature flower; The spikelet is extremely small, leaving only a crescent shaped mark at the tip of the peduncle, cone-shaped; The lemma on both sides of the pregnant flower is thick in texture, with 5 veins, and the midrib forms a ridge. The surface has small milk like protrusions in a square shape, which are thick and papery, and are covered with fine hairs with dense end hairs; The inner lemma and outer lemma are homogenous, with 3 veins, and the apex is pointed without a beak; The stamen anthers are 2-3 millimeters long.
